Figueira da Foz – Montemor-o-Velha – Serra de Boa Viagem

The mondaine town Figueira da Foz has restaurants and casino’s allong the long boulevard, and a wide sandy beach. It is also easy to reach from Mortágua, taking the IP3 and the (toll) A14. On the way to Figueira you pass the Mondego delta, with a large variety of water birds such as storcks and white herons, and even flamingo’s. A unique landscape. Close to Figueira lies the castle ruin of Montemor-o-velho. It is worth to leave the highway to take a look. North of Figueira da Foz is the forrested area called Serra de Boa Viagem. Taking the Figueira boulevard northwards, you automaticaly end up there. Here you find century old Eucalypt trees and beautifull paths with breathtaking views on the ocean.
